Week 0-2: Kittens are born in one of my kittens are rooms in a safe enclosed pop up fabric kennel. The room is set to 85 degrees and mama's have a soft fabric nursing box. Kittens have fresh washable pads and weighed daily to check their progress! During these first two weeks moms may try to move their kittens so they will not have free access to leave.
My husband and I take turns checking on kittens what feels like every hour! We want to make sure kittens are comfortable & at a safe temperature. I gently touch the kittens for very short periods so they become accustomed early to being held.
Initially I begin with short intermissions of petting all areas of the kitten’s body softly (paw pads, belly, tail, around the face).
Week 3-4: Kittens eyes are now fully open and kittens are now able to be carried comfortably. They have started to venture outside of their nursing box and meow sooo much! they go limp when held and love me giving kisses. My husband, myself or one of my kitty helpers will carry the kittens around the house or while doing online work.
I practice light stressors such as holding them upside down and continue to touch their paws. Can't forget to smother them in kisses! At the end of this age they are introduced to litter boxes and raw food while mainly nursing.
I also start to play their YouTube TV (puppy desensitization videos) during the day. This helps desensitize kittens to loud noises!
Week 5-8: Kittens are exploring and becoming very playful. I now take them to different rooms of the house to explore and encourage cuddling on the bed. This met with mixed results and some meowing haha.
They are used to more 'aggressive handling' and are comfortable with all types of interaction. At this time they receive their first bath while using a lickable cat treat. They will receive 2-3+ baths before going home. I also have guests start coming to socialize babies.
Week 8-10: Kittens are still being held daily, kissed very frequently and interreacting with guests. Kittens have been are now introduced to the Petkit Automatic Litter robot and get to explore the living room now!
They play with even more guests during Kitten Cuddles Visits and experience a variety of different people. They become part of the home and our family. I will do a few training hours of hanging out in their individual carriers. I make sure all kittens have acquired appropriate grooming & litter box habits and are outgoing & ready to adjust to their new homes. We practice nail cutting more and brushing!
Week 11-14: During this time kittens will have gotten spayed and neutered. I make sure they are in great health for their new homes as well as fully litter box trained.
Kittens are super used to all aspects of grooming, which includes brushing and nails. Every kitten should be easy to handle and touch! You should expect to keep up with holding as they age. If you do not use a skill, you loose it!

Mothers live in a pop up fabric pen a week before they give birth. This keeps mom stress-free and the newborn safe from improper nesting spots.
I keep the moms with their newborns in one of my two kitten nursery rooms. There are ring cameras aimed at each pen and with the help of my husband and kitty helpers we all check on & handle the kittens multiple times a day.
I change the bedding & weight kittens daily, assist in birthing and administer supportive care such as milk replacement.
I keep the rooms quiet and protected from draft so the comfort of mama. This room is kept toasty at 83 degrees.
The moms that get along can raise their kittens together. Each mom has access to come and go as she pleases from the kitten’s wooden acrylic playpen once kittens reach 4-6 weeks of age. The moms that get along can raise their kittens together. Each mom has access to come and go as she pleases from the kitten’s wooden acrylic playpen once kittens reach 4-6 weeks of age. Mom's usually spend less and less time with kittens as they start to wean. All kittens are started on raw as early as 3-4 weeks! No special recipe is needed to transition them. ❤️
I use washable peepads and flushable cat litter for training kittens. Once kittens are 5-6 weeks I add in toys and scratchers. Everyday I spend atleast 30 mins-1 hour per litter handling and socializing every kitten. This does not include the time my husband or helpers also spent with them!
At 6 weeks, the kittens get to spend supervised play time with their older siblings. They gain a ton of confidence this way!
Every 1-2 days I change bedding, scoop litter, sanitize toys, bath messy kittens and clean up food from raw feeding (it can get messy!).
All kittens learn how to use Petkit automatic litter boxes at 10+ weeks before leaving. I also have a TV in the room that plays desensitizing sounds throughout the day.
